History

I've been in the hobby 10 years, this tank is 4.5 years old. I had a total coral crash 2.5 years ago from a plumbing mishap, so what you see is 2.5 years of growth from tiny little 1/2" frags. I got all my corals from fellow reefers and most of them come from our yearly swap in Lansing (each January). Yes I have a table this year, and will be selling again. I've been around on MR and RC for years and this seems to be the new place to be. I've been a bit drained by the hobby since I got married... kinda sapped all my finances for impulse builds. I did recently build a new LED prototype though as shown. I started with FOWLR, then into a small nano tank with softies and power compact like most. I consider myself an expert when it comes to system desgin, but only below average when it comes to fish/coral nomenclature. I have tried just about everything and have came full circle to the basics.

Water Quality, Lighting, Flow. All must be correct in that order or you will grow nothing colorful.

zachtos
12-02-2011, 12:40 PM
I'm running the halides on the main tank, and the LED on the anemone tank. The colors are too far off to mix it in with my halides. I think I may use the LED light for a frag tank light, or a desktop office tank (15G with SPS frags from my main tank). There are so many variables to growing coral. It's easy to blame your lighting, but 9/10 times is your water quality. If you have around 300-500 PAR you should be able to grow just about anything.

Everything still going fine. I'm still recovering from a nitrate/phosphate issue after nuking the flatworms 4 months ago. I removed the zeovit crap because it did nothing over a year except waste time/money. Water changes, skimming, macro algae growing and careful feeding is the real key to water quality control. I'm running granular ferric oxide 1/2lb per 2 weeks to assist with phosphate removal for a few months. Still doing 6 cups carbon / 2 weeks and filter socks. Also up to 8ml vodka/sugar/vinegar each day. XM10K bulbs at 1.5 years old and going strong.

If I had to pick 3 corals for my next tank, they would be the Red planet, peach/green milli and palmer blue milli. They are true red/green/blue. They hold color well and are fairly fast growers. A few orange/purple montis would round out the color wheel. True yellows are still non existent.

full tank shot as of 3/18/13. Still running reeflux12k 400w mh x 3 and a LED fixture on the far right side (cree 36 leds). Doing carbon dosing (vodka), small refugium, live rock, calcium reactor, skimmer w/ bubble blaster 4000?, GACarbon, 1.5 WC per month at 60G each, running about 400g water after displacement. What's keeping your feeding stick there?

It's just a PVC pipe w/ fishing line. I hang it from the center beam of the tank and wrap nori around the pipe with rubber bands. I buy nori in huge boxes and use about 2 sheets per day. The fish are too big for those clips, they rip it off, then it rots in my SPS branches where they cant reach them, and it causes coral death. So this solution keeps the nori secure and the fish out in the center of the tank. I saw someone else online do it I think.
